Postby ofey » Mon Apr 09, 2012 6:17 pm

To be honest 0W40 is OTT for a NA car.
You will find that a 5W30 would be more than appropriate for your use.

Postby exaltd » Mon Apr 09, 2012 11:02 pm

I might suggest as well that '0w' is too thin for our cars, according to manufacturers specifications. But being in Gold Coast, you might just be able to get away with it in hot weather, Not recommended for those in colder climates though.
